A modified Fejer and Jackson summability method with respect to orthogonal polynomials.

Let {P-n](n=0)(infinity) be an orthogonal polynomial system on the real line with respect to a measure mu with compact support S. Following the classical methods, we define a modified Fejer and Jackson summability method for Fourier series with respect to {Pn](n=0)(infinity). There is a discussion for ultraspherical polynomials. Moreover, we give error estimates for positive summability methods.
